Frank LaPorte
Frank Breyfogle LaPorte (Pot)
Bats: Right , Throws: Right
Height: 5' 8" , Weight: 175 lb.

Born: February 6, 1880 in Uhrichsville, OH (All Transactions)
Debut: September 29, 1905
Final Game: October 3, 1915
Died: September 25, 1939 in Newcomerstown, OH

August 25, 1905: Purchased by the New York Highlanders from Buffalo (Eastern). (Date given is approximate. Exact date is uncertain.)

October 13, 1907: Traded as part of a 3-team trade by the New York Highlanders to the Boston Americans. The Chicago White Sox sent Jake Stahl to the New York Highlanders. The Boston Americans sent Freddy Parent to the Chicago White Sox.

August 17, 1908: Traded by the Boston Red Sox to the New York Highlanders for Harry Niles.

February 11, 1911: Traded by the New York Highlanders with Jimmy Austin to the St. Louis Browns for Roy Hartzell and cash.

August 6, 1912: Purchased by the Washington Senators from the St. Louis Browns.

Before 1914 Season: Jumped from the Washington Senators to the Indianapolis Hoosiers.
